What they do

A Production Planner plans and manages production and distribution processes for a company and identifies ways to improve efficiency. Analyzes work flows, plans and schedules orders, manages materials orders and monitors inventory; coordinates with suppliers and vendors.

Job Description:
Production Planner/Scheduler Plans, schedules, coordinates, and monitors the flow of products through the complete production cycle. Provides timely planning and scheduling of manufacturing work orders to the manufacturing floor to achieve both customer delivery dates and optimize throughput / mix efficiency. Monitors capacity versus utilization and provides routine reports on status and recommendations. Collaborates with Customer Service to ensure new orders achieve +90% on time delivery. Prepares outlook report for demand planning based on history and sales input, versus capacity and parts / materials constraints, periods: 30-60-90-120 days.
Accountabilities:
Review open sales orders to determine customer requirements Coordinate delivery of parts to expedite flow of material to meet production schedule Support purchasing and recommend expedite purchase orders if required Utilize ERP system to auto‐generate manufacturing work orders Release manufacturing work orders to the warehouse for kit picking Coordinate between warehouse and purchasing on material shortages Notify Customer Service of schedule impacts to customers Coordinate/expedite manufacturing builds and monitor WIP to ensure schedules are achieved Completes status reports including but not limited to production progress; customer information; materials inventory; capacity and utilization analysis; WIP level
Requirements:
Production and processing knowledge; parts and raw materials; production processes; quality control; costs; and other techniques for maximizing the effective manufacture of products Communication skills to interact effectively and courteously with stakeholders Ability to read write and communicate effectively in English Proficient use of computer systems and software applications In‐depth knowledge of ERP and MRP software Degree in supply chain or industrial engineering preferred APICS certification preferred Experience preferred in production planning or inventory and material management .
